GATOR1-dependent recruitment of FLCN–FNIP to lysosomes coordinates Rag GTPase heterodimer nucleotide status in response to amino acids
Folliculin (FLCN) is a tumor suppressor that coordinates cellular responses to changes in amino acid availability via regulation of the Rag guanosine triphosphatases.
